Job Summary
We are seeking an experienced and detail-oriented Panel Beater to join our Workshop & Maintenance team. The role is responsible for repairing, restoring, and maintaining the bodywork of company trucks, trailers, and other vehicles to ensure they remain in excellent condition, both functionally and aesthetically. The ideal candidate will have expertise in welding, body alignment, dent removal, and finishing techniques, with a strong commitment to quality and safety.
Job Responsibilities
- Assess vehicle body damage and recommend appropriate repair methods.
- Repair and replace damaged panels, frames, and other structural parts of trucks and trailers.
- Carry out dent removal, straightening, welding, and panel alignment.
- Fit replacement parts such as doors, bumpers, fenders, and chassis components.
- Ensure correct use of tools and materials to restore vehicles to safe and functional condition.
- Perform sanding, filling, priming, and surface preparation for painting.
- Maintain proper records of body repairs and parts replaced.
- Ensure all repair work meets company and industry safety standards.
- Collaborate with mechanics, painters, and other technicians in the workshop.
- Maintain a clean and organized work environment and take responsibility for workshop tools.
